Analysis of "Omron PLC Password Unlock Software V4.2"

In the landscape of industrial automation, Programmable Logic Controllers (PLCs) manufactured by Omron are critical components used to control machinery and processes across various industries. To protect intellectual property and prevent unauthorized modifications, these PLCs are often secured with passwords. This necessity for security has given rise to third-party tools, such as the alleged "Omron PLC Password Unlock Software V4.2," which claims to bypass or recover these security measures.

The Functionality and Appeal The software in question typically belongs to a category of utilities designed for password recovery or backup restoration. In legitimate scenarios, these tools can be invaluable for system integrators or maintenance engineers who need to access a PLC when the original programmer is unavailable, or the password has been lost. The "V4.2" designation suggests a specific iteration of such software, presumably offering compatibility with a range of Omron PLC series, such as the CP1H, CP1L, or CJ series. The primary appeal of this software is its promise to regain access to the controller’s memory, allowing for troubleshooting, modifications, or data extraction without the need to replace the hardware.

Technical Mechanisms Most tools of this nature operate by exploiting vulnerabilities in the PLC’s firmware communication protocols or by utilizing brute-force algorithms to guess the password. Unlike modern IT cybersecurity, which often employs complex encryption and lockout policies, older industrial controllers sometimes utilized simpler protection schemes. Software claiming to "unlock" these devices often interacts with the PLC via the serial or USB port, sending specific instruction sets that trick the processor into revealing the password or allowing a memory upload without authentication.

Security Risks and Ethical Implications While the utility of such software is apparent in "lockout" situations, the existence and use of "Omron PLC Password Unlock Software V4.2" raise significant security and ethical concerns. The primary risk involves the source of the software. Unlike official vendor tools distributed by Omron (such as CX-Programmer or CX-One), third-party unlock utilities are frequently hosted on unverified websites or forums. Downloading and executing these programs poses a severe risk of malware infection, including ransomware or trojans, which could compromise not just the engineering workstation but the entire industrial network.

Furthermore, the use of password bypass tools violates the integrity of the controller’s security architecture. By circumventing the password, the software essentially renders the device’s protection useless. This creates a vector for industrial espionage, sabotage, or unauthorized alteration of safety-critical code. In regulated industries, using unauthorized tools to modify controller logic can lead to compliance violations and void equipment warranties.

Legitimate Alternatives For professionals locked out of an Omron PLC, the recommended course of action is to pursue official channels. Omron provides specific procedures for password recovery, which may involve contacting technical support with proof of ownership. In cases where recovery is impossible, the official Omron programming software (CX-Programmer) includes features to clear the PLC memory—effectively wiping the protected program but restoring the hardware to a usable state. While this results in the loss of the existing logic, it ensures the hardware remains functional without compromising cybersecurity.

Conclusion "Omron PLC Password Unlock Software V4.2" represents the double-edged sword of industrial utility tools: it offers a quick fix for lost credentials but introduces substantial risks regarding system integrity and cyber hygiene. While the demand for such tools highlights a real-world gap in legacy system management, reliance on unauthorized bypass software undermines the safety and security posture of industrial environments. The responsible approach prioritizes official vendor support and established recovery protocols over the convenience of third-party unlocking utilities.

Understanding Omron PLC Password Protection

Omron PLCs, such as the CP1H, CP1L, CP1E, CJ1M, and CJ2M series, use "UM Read Protection" to prevent unauthorized users from uploading or overwriting program data. This protection is essential for intellectual property and operational safety.

When a password is lost, engineers often search for version-specific tools like V4.2. These utilities typically exploit known communication vulnerabilities (such as CVE-2022-2003) to force the PLC to return the password in plain text or bypass the authentication check entirely. The Risks of Third-Party "Unlock" Software

While various websites and forums offer downloads for PLC HMI Password Unlock V4.2, these tools are not official Omron products. Security researchers from firms like Dragos have found that many of these utilities are "trojanized".

Malware Infection: Many "cracked" versions of these tools include droppers for the Sality botnet. Once run on an Engineering Workstation (EWS), the malware can disable firewalls, steal credentials, and even use the workstation for cryptocurrency mining.

Operational Risk: Unofficial tools can cause communication errors or even corrupt the PLC's internal memory during the "unlock" process, potentially bricking the hardware. User Experience The user interface of the Omron

Network Vulnerability: Using these tools may inadvertently open backdoors in your industrial network, exposing critical infrastructure to remote attackers. Countermeasure for password function vulnerability of PLCs

What is Omron PLC Password Unlock Software V4.2?

First, it is critical to understand that Omron Corporation does not officially release or endorse "password unlock" software. The version "V4.2" is a designation typically attached to third-party, reverse-engineered, or gray-market utilities designed to bypass or recover lost passwords on Omron PLCs.

These tools target specific legacy Omron series—most notably the C, CV, CS/CJ, and CP1 families. Version 4.2 implies a specific build that many users claim supports the following:

  • Bypassing UM (User Memory) read protection – Allows uploading the program from a locked PLC.
  • Bypassing Write protection – Allows overwriting a forgotten password with a new one.
  • Recovery of 8-character or 16-character hexadecimal passwords used in older Omron systems.

Unlike official Omron software (CX-Programmer), which requires a valid password to upload or modify code, V4.2 tools attempt to interact with the PLC's firmware at a lower level or exploit known vulnerabilities in the FINS (Factory Interface Network Service) protocol.

Omron Plc Password Unlock Software V4.2 — Reference Survey

Overview

  • Product: Omron PLC Password Unlock Software V4.2
  • Purpose: Tools marketed to recover, reset, or bypass passwords on Omron programmable logic controllers (PLCs) and related devices, typically to regain access to ladder logic, configuration, or operation when credentials are lost.
  • Typical users: Industrial automation technicians, maintenance engineers, system integrators, emergency recovery consultants.

Key features (commonly advertised)

  • Supports multiple Omron PLC families (often including older CP/M-series and newer CJ/CS/CJ1/CJ2, Sysmac NJ/NX depending on vendor claims).
  • Ability to read PLC model and firmware version.
  • Password reset or removal routines for PLC ladders and project protection.
  • Backup and restore of PLC memory and user programs.
  • Serial (RS-232/RS-485) and Ethernet connection support (vendor-dependent).
  • Simple GUI with device autodetect and logging.
  • Compatibility with specific Windows versions (often Windows 7/8/10; check vendor notes).

Typical workflow

  1. Connect PC to PLC via recommended physical interface (serial/USB-serial adapter, Ethernet).
  2. Launch software and identify PLC model and firmware.
  3. Initiate password recovery/unlock procedure — may involve reading device memory, exploiting firmware commands, or sending special unlock packets.
  4. Save recovered program or set new password.
  5. Verify PLC operation and reapply protections as needed.

Compatibility and system requirements

  • PLC models: Varies by vendor build; verify supported models and firmware revisions before use.
  • Communication hardware: RS-232/RS-485 converter or Ethernet; some operations require a console/maintenance port.
  • OS: Typically Windows desktop OS; confirm 32-/64-bit and driver requirements.
  • Backup: Ensure you can back up PLC memory before attempting changes.

Limitations and risks

  • Not officially supported by Omron: Third-party “password unlock” tools are generally not authorized by PLC manufacturers and may void warranties or violate support agreements.
  • Bricking risk: Incorrect use can corrupt PLC memory or firmware, causing device failure or requiring manufacturer service.
  • Incomplete support: Newer PLC models and firmware patches may block known recovery methods; software claims of broad compatibility can be inaccurate.
  • Safety hazards: Altering control programs in safety-critical systems can create dangerous conditions; changes should be performed only by qualified personnel with proper safety procedures and supervised downtime.
  • Legal and compliance risks: Unauthorized access to controllers on equipment you do not own or manage may be illegal or breach contractual terms.

Security and ethics

  • Use only on equipment you own, manage, or have explicit permission to service.
  • Maintain chain-of-custody and change logs when recovering or modifying controllers.
  • Restore passwords or apply replacements and notify stakeholders; avoid leaving devices unprotected in production.

Alternatives and official options

  • Contact Omron support for authorized password reset procedures, repair, or replacement services.
  • Restore from documented backups or source control where available.
  • Rebuild logic from exported program archives, project files, or by reverse-engineering with caution.
  • Engage certified Omron integrators or field service engineers.

Practical recommendations before attempting unlock

  • Verify you have explicit authorization to access the device.
  • Obtain device model, serial number, firmware version, and current configuration backups.
  • Document current state (screenshots, memory dump) and take full backup if possible.
  • Perform recovery on a maintenance copy or during scheduled downtime.
  • If device controls safety systems, follow lockout/tagout and safety procedures.
  • Test thoroughly in a non-production environment before redeploying.

Troubleshooting notes

  • Connection issues: check correct cable type, baud rate, and COM port settings.
  • Model unsupported: tool may fail to detect or communicate—confirm vendor compatibility list.
  • Firmware mismatch: methods may require particular firmware ranges; research known supported versions.
  • If unlock fails or PLC becomes unresponsive, contacting Omron or a qualified service provider is recommended.

References and due diligence

  • Verify any third-party software vendor reputation, version changelogs, and user reports before use.
  • Search vendor forums and industrial automation communities for model-specific experiences and recovery notes.
  • Keep firmware and programming software updated and maintain secure, versioned backups to avoid future lockouts.
